Empower Highlights the Role of Energy Efficiency in the Future of Sustainable Cooling at 11th World Future Energy Summit

Emirates Central Cooling Systems Corporation (EMPOWER), the world's biggest area cooling down service provider, is taking part at the 11th World Future Energy Summit (WFES), the leading occasion for the clean energy and energy efficiency, which is being held from 15 to 18 January 2017 at the Abu Dhabi National Exhibition Centre (ADNEC). The company drops the spotlight on the function of energy and water performance in the future of lasting cooling and is additionally showcasing the most up to date version of its energy-efficient area air conditioning plant in Business Bay. Empower highlights the sustainable functions of its area cooling solutions in line with the highest international standards and the UAE Power Plan 2050 campaign, which targets to promote a culture of preservation, including consuming 50 percent of power from tidy power by the same year. District cooling is thought about by the United Nations as an energy-efficient cooling modern technology, which aids conserve energy and water sources and reduces the carbon impact from electrical power usage. Additionally, Empower's acclaimed TSE Technology, where Treated Sewage Effluent is refined further and utilized in the production of chilled water, so as conserving big on priceless safe and clean water, is worldwide recognised as a design for saving on water resources in power effectiveness practices.

Empower currently provides environmentally responsible district air conditioning services to large property developments such as Jumeirah Group properties, Business Bay, Jumeirah Beach Residence, Dubai International Financial Centre, Palm Jumeirah, Jumeirah Lake Towers, Ibn Battuta Mall, Discovery Gardens, Dubai Healthcare City, Dubai World Trade Centre Residences, and Dubai Design District, among others.
